Abstract :
This paper focuses on an introduction to the test and measurement of different commercially available wireless standards. The different wireless working groups each present the unique specifications for the PHY in their standard documents. And while it may seem overwhelming to start working with new standards, the concepts for, and requirements of, physical layer analysis are largely transferable between them. This paper presents an introduction to the most common measurements needed to test the physical layers of modern communication protocols.
